private void button1_Click(object sender, EventArgs e) { OpenFileDialog ofd = new OpenFileDialog(); if (ofd.ShowDialog() == DialogResult.OK) { FileStream stream = new FileStream(ofd.FileName, FileMode.Open, FileAccess.ReadWrite, FileShare.ReadWrite); BinaryReader reader = new BinaryReader(stream); BinaryWriter writer = new BinaryWriter(stream); RE4Checksum.RE4Checksum re4c = new RE4Checksum.RE4Checksum(); // Data checked is at 0x1EE4 for length of 0x1FC. This MUST be computed first! reader.BaseStream.Position = 0x1EE4; uint CRC = re4c.Compute(reader.ReadBytes(0x1FC), 0x1FC); // First checsum location is at 0x1EE0 writer.BaseStream.Position = 0x1EE0; // Write as big endian writer.Write(BitConverter.GetBytes(BSwapUint(CRC))); writer.Flush(); // Second part of the data checked is at 0x1EE0 for length of 0xCAF8 reader.BaseStream.Position = 0x1EE0; CRC = re4c.Compute(reader.ReadBytes(0xCAF8), 0xCAF8); // Second checksum location is at 0xE9D8 writer.BaseStream.Position = 0xE9D8; // Write as big endian writer.Write(BitConverter.GetBytes(BSwapUint(CRC))); writer.Flush(); // Third checksum location is at 0xFFA90 (unchecked by the game but doing this for keeping save integrity) writer.BaseStream.Position = 0xFFA90; // Write as big endian writer.Write(BitConverter.GetBytes(BSwapUint(CRC))); writer.Flush(); stream.Close(); MessageBox.Show("Resign Completed!"); } }
